Output 377f540fe89deaff9e6709cbf8ebae7c6aaa1adab17c5625f57a79cbf28ed0f9:15

value
10638000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f19acfa8a5d927028c8b23ef9c13d15ee3fe492 OP_EQUAL
address
34XTdUArwRL864izQGwFEj7bKzTdtPiYwD
transaction
377f540fe89deaff9e6709cbf8ebae7c6aaa1adab17c5625f57a79cbf28ed0f9
spent
true